[Biological effect of seed-coating in Carthamus tinctorins]

Zhongguo Zhong Yao Za Zhi. 2003 Aug;28(8):714-8.
[Article in Chinese]

Abstract

Objective: To study the Biological effect of seed-coating in Carthamus tinctorins.

Method: Two kinds of seedcoating chemicals SCF1 and SCF2 were used in this experiment, the seed YM-99 and 27981-99 were coated by three kinds of ratio of seedcoating chemicals to seed. It was investigated that the germination energy and germination percentage in the room and the emergence rate, seedling stage growing, pest in the field.

Result: Seedoating can improve the emergence rate and seedling stage growing, it also can effectively control aphid, rust and virosis during the growing period in C. tinctorins.

Conclusion: Seedcoating has significant biological effect in C. tinctorins.
